MEMO — Seed samples, Plot 14 trial

Shift lead: the Greywick agronomy team needs the Tollan barley seed samples moved out tonight. Twelve sealed pouches, cold-stored, bay C. Courier from Fenholt Express arrives end of shift. Pouches stay in the insulated tote — do not split the lot. Log the tote weight before release and note it on the run sheet. No substitutions if a pouch looks short; flag it and hold. At hand-over, the courier must follow the instruction below.

handover note for yagef-bagep: the drudor pelius courier leaves the kasdor zorvan norir ledger at gate 8016 under passcode 755406

Subject: Loan pieces heading out this week

Hi dispatch,

Quick heads-up: the three exhibition pieces we're loaning to the Wrenmoor Gallery are crated and waiting in the east corridor. The tall crate is top-heavy, so keep it strapped upright — the conservator will have my head otherwise. Paperwork is taped to crate two in the yellow sleeve; the condition reports stay with us, copies only travel. Pickup is Thursday morning. When the courier arrives, follow this hand-over instruction to the letter.

handover note for bahif-kahop: the ulaion zoriel courier leaves the ralath eliath briael gorael fenael holax istion jorael ledger at gate 6810 under passcode 736093

Handover: cold bucket archiving

Hey team — wrapping up my week on the Frostvault archiving work. All cold storage buckets older than 180 days in the Merrowdale region are now tagged for the glacier tier, except the three flagged by billing (those need sign-off). The migration script is idempotent, so rerunning it is safe if the sync stalls. Jonas is picking this up Monday; main thing left is verifying checksums post-move. Full state and the remaining bucket list are tracked on the internal page below.

wiki page, tahaf-tajog: https://jira.ordindyn.corp/pipeline